										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Meth secures R381m lifeline to save SA post pffice jobs</p>
<p>Minister of Employment and Labour, Nomakhosazana Meth, has announced a R381 million lifeline to stabilize the South African Post Office (SAPO), safeguarding nearly 6,000 jobs. </p>
<p>The funding, provided through the Unemployment Insurance Fund’s Temporary Employer-Employee Relief Scheme (TERS), was formalized on May 18, via a Memorandum of Agreement between SAPO and the UIF.</p>
<p>The six-month intervention aims to provide immediate financial relief to 5,956 employees while SAPO implements a turnaround strategy to address its ongoing financial crisis. </p>
<p>“This is a bold step to protect workers and restore confidence in our public institutions,” Meth said, emphasizing the TERS program’s role in stabilizing employment and supporting economic recovery.</p>
<p>SAPO, under business rescue since 2023, previously received a R2.4 billion bailout in 2023/24, but business rescue practitioners warn an additional R3.8 billion is needed for a full recovery. Despite fiscal challenges, Meth’s initiative underscores the government’s commitment to job preservation and reforming state-owned enterprises, with SAPO projecting profitability by 2028.</p>
